Wife of the double Olympic champion Evgenia Plushenko Yana Rudkovskaya, in an interview with RT, spoke about her husband’s injury during the Sochi Olympics in 2014.
In his fourth Games, Plushenko helped the team win gold in the team tournament, after which he retired from individual competition due to a back injury.
– If the withdrawal from the 2014 Games in Sochi was really a scenario, I would have, believe me, calculated it to the smallest detail. The problem is that what happened could not be predicted at all. After the team tournament, Zhenya signed all withdrawal documents, all of which have been kept to this day. But at three in the morning the next day, right after doping control, we were dragged into a meeting. I always have this image in front of me: Alexey Mishin, Alexander Gorshkov and Vitaly Mutko call – and they all say that the situation is hopeless and that you must participate. Zhenya tried to object – he was in terrible pain. And yet he was persuaded, – said Rudkovskaya.
– As the surgeon Ilya Pekarsky, who operated on Zhenya in Israel, later said, if the husband had not taken off after warming up, but went skating on the program and fell, then most likely he would have died on the ice . Zhenya himself later admitted that the pain was such that he did not really understand what was happening to him. Probably, I am also to blame here: it was necessary to dissuade Evgeny from speaking. But he was too convinced that he alone is capable of helping the team, she added.
